The Formula

How the Semester Grade Calculation Works

A weighted average formula used in classrooms across the United States.

Semester Grade Formula

Semester Grade = Σ (Category Score × Category Weight)
Category Score — your average score in that category
Category Weight — the % that category contributes to your grade
Σ — sum of all weighted category scores

📘 Worked Example

Category Your Score Weight Weighted Score
Homework92%20%92 × 0.20 = 18.4
Quizzes85%20%85 × 0.20 = 17.0
Midterm Exam78%25%78 × 0.25 = 19.5
Final Exam88%35%88 × 0.35 = 30.8

Semester Grade

85.7% — Letter Grade B

18.4 + 17.0 + 19.5 + 30.8 = 85.7%

Standard Grade Scale

Letter Grade Percentage Range GPA Points Status
A90% – 100%4.0Excellent
B80% – 89%3.0Above Average
C70% – 79%2.0Average
D60% – 69%1.0Below Average
F0% – 59%0.0Failing

How Weighted Categories Affect Your Semester Grade

How the Weighting Works

Most US high school and college courses divide grading into weighted assignment categories. These typically include homework, quizzes, midterm exams, and final exams. Each category carries a specific percentage of the total grade as defined in the course syllabus and grading policy set by your instructor. The National Center for Education Statistics tracks grading and academic performance data across US schools and colleges.

Why Category Weight Changes Everything

A student who scores 95% on every homework assignment but struggles on exams may still finish with a B or C. That happens when exam categories carry 60% or more of the total weight. Understanding this helps you decide where to focus your effort — especially in the final weeks of a term. Tips for Improving Your Semester Grade Before the Term Ends

Focus on High-Weight Assignments

Once you know your current semester grade, you can make strategic decisions. Identify which remaining assignments carry the highest weight. Focus your preparation time there. A 35% final exam has far more grade-improvement potential than a 5% quiz.

Check Every Option Available to You

Look at your syllabus for extra credit opportunities, late submission policies, or grade replacement options. Many instructors offer these but students miss them entirely. How do I calculate my semester grade with weights?
To calculate your weighted semester grade, multiply your score in each category by that category's weight, then add all the results together. For example, if you scored 85% on homework (worth 20%) and 90% on exams (worth 80%), your semester grade is (85 × 0.20) + (90 × 0.80) = 17 + 72 = 89%. Make sure your category weights add up to 100% or the result will be inaccurate. What if my category weights don't add up to 100%?
If your category weights don't total 100%, your semester grade calculation will be inaccurate — the result will be either inflated or deflated depending on whether the weights sum to more or less than 100%. Always check your course syllabus carefully to confirm the exact weight assigned to each grading category before entering values into the calculator. Some instructors drop the lowest quiz score or exclude certain assignments, which can affect the effective category weights. If you are unsure about your course weights, contact your teacher or check your school's learning management system for the official grading breakdown.

How is a semester grade different from a cumulative GPA?
A semester grade reflects your performance in a single course during one term, expressed as a percentage or letter grade. A cumulative GPA, by contrast, is a weighted average of your letter grades across all courses taken over multiple semesters, calculated using grade points and credit hours. Your semester grade feeds into your cumulative GPA — a strong semester grade in a high-credit course will raise your GPA more than the same grade in a low-credit course.
